An exciting opportunity has arisen for a Stores Operative to join a long-established and respected manufacturing company. This is a varied, hands-on role where you will support the day-to-day running of the Stores department, ensuring the efficient receipt, storage, movement and dispatch of materials throughout the factory.

You will work closely with production, purchasing and stores teams to maintain stock accuracy and ensure materials are available to support manufacturing operations. This role also offers the opportunity to provide cover for the Stores Supervisor during periods of absence.

Duties of a Stores Operative:

  • Issue consumable materials and loan tools, accurately recording all stock transactions.
  • Receive and inspect deliveries, checking quantities against purchase orders and reporting any discrepancies or quality issues.
  • Match delivery notes with purchase orders and distribute documentation to the Purchasing department.
  • Pick and prepare materials for production using pick lists generated by the MRP system.
  • Prepare, package and dispatch customer and supplier consignments, ensuring goods are securely packed for transit.
  • Assist with stock control, traceability records and maintaining required inventory levels.
  • Support general warehouse housekeeping, ensuring stores and material handling equipment are clean, organised and safe.
  • Deliver and collect materials as required.
  • Build effective working relationships with production supervisors and other departments.
  • Provide cover for the Stores Supervisor when required.
  • Contribute ideas to improve stores procedures and material handling processes.
